vue ThreeSelect 自定义
时间: 2024-04-22 18:22:42 浏览: 12
如果您想要自定义vue ThreeSelect组件,可以按照以下步骤进行:
1. 创建一个新的vue组件文件,例如MyThreeSelect.vue。在这个组件中,您可以使用vue ThreeSelect组件作为基础,并添加一些自定义的样式和功能。
2. 在MyThreeSelect.vue组件中,通过props接收vue ThreeSelect组件的props,如options、value、labelKey等。您可以根据自己的需求来定义新的props。
3. 在MyThreeSelect.vue组件中,使用vue ThreeSelect组件的template,并添加一些自定义的样式和结构。您可以使用CSS和HTML来实现自己的需求。
4. 在MyThreeSelect.vue组件中,使用vue ThreeSelect组件的methods,如updateValue和updateOptions等,来实现自己的业务逻辑。您可以根据自己的需求来定义新的methods。
5. 在父组件中,使用MyThreeSelect.vue组件,传递props和监听事件。您可以根据自己的需求来定义props和事件。
总之,自定义vue ThreeSelect组件可以让您根据自己的需求来实现一些自定义的样式和功能,提高用户体验。
相关问题
vue日历自定义组件
我很抱歉,但是我无法直接通过引用内容查看具体的图片和代码。然而,根据你提供的引用信息,我可以告诉你关于vue日历自定义组件的一些信息。
根据引用,这个组件目录可以提供给你一些关于vue日历自定义组件的相关代码和文件。
根据引用,这个vue日历组件支持农历和假期展示,并且可以自定义可选择的日期范围。
根据引用,在组件中使用这个vue日历组件,你需要在main.js中引入它。组件默认情况下会显示一个自定义的左侧icon。某一个日期可以出现选中状态,也可以使用圆点模式来表示选中状态。你可以通过传递一个包含active属性的数组对象来自定义某一天的数据。
总的来说,这个vue日历自定义组件提供了一些可定制化的功能,包括农历展示、假期展示以及可选择日期范围等。你可以根据你的需求在组件中进行相应的配置和使用。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[vue自定义日历组件](https://blog.csdn.net/weixin_38644883/article/details/88067612)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* [vue日历组件,支持农历以及假期展示,可以自定义可选择日期范围](https://download.csdn.net/download/qq_29597215/86267518)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
vue 全局自定义指令
好的,关于 Vue 全局自定义指令,可以通过 Vue.directive() 方法来实现。具体步骤如下:
1. 在 Vue 实例化之前,通过 Vue.directive() 方法定义指令:
```
Vue.directive('my-directive', {
bind: function (el, binding, vnode) {
// 指令绑定时的操作
},
inserted: function (el, binding, vnode) {
// 元素插入到 DOM 中时的操作
},
update: function (el, binding, vnode, oldVnode) {
// 元素更新时的操作
},
componentUpdated: function (el, binding, vnode, oldVnode) {
// 组件更新时的操作
},
unbind: function (el, binding, vnode) {
// 指令解绑时的操作
}
})
```
2. 在模板中使用指令:
```
<div v-my-directive></div>
```
其中,v-my-directive 就是自定义指令的名称。